Is it worth having a dishwasher?

It is practically a consensus among dishwasher owners that it, when of quality and adequate to the needs of the house, works miracles in the routine. In addition to practicality and time savings, the dishwasher is also associated with reducing water consumption.

According to data from Sabesp, washing the dishes in the sink – with the tap half open – for 15 minutes consumes, on average, 117 liters of water.

The number can rise to 243 liters in apartments, where water pressure is usually strongest. Dishwasher machines have an average consumption of 10 liters per complete cycle, which washes 60 to 150 items, depending on the model and capacity.

High energy consumption is a very common myth linked to dishwashers, but it is no longer a reality. The current models have mechanisms that guarantee very satisfactory savings rates.

The ideal machine is one that can handle the amount of dirty dishes produced daily by the family. Buying a dishwasher with a capacity above or below the actual need can be a big problem, since turning it on partially empty means wasting water and electricity.

On the other hand, putting it to work filled with crockery in excess of the indicated quantity can affect the performance of the washing machine and the quality of the washing.

When used correctly and with the right products, most washers are capable of even heavy cleaning of pots and utensils. Some even use heat for washing and drying, eliminating germs and bacteria from dishes and utensils.

Although more expensive, cleaning products for dishwashers require less quantity and yield a lot. A kilo of washing powder costs about R $ 15, yielding an average of 50 washes. The 100 ml drying liquid costs about R $ 10, and is sufficient for up to 300 washes.

What to pay attention to when installing a dishwasher?

Installation forms may vary according to the brand, model and place where the dishwasher will be. Make sure that the machine is installed in the best location: as close as possible to road points and water depletion.

Check before purchase which material is required for installation, and if it comes with the product. In case of installation in small or peculiar places, some adapters may be necessary. Search ahead to find out if accessories are available in your region.

Some models have videos and online tutorials for installation, which can help with the service. If you find the steps difficult to perform, or are not very adept at the task, consider hiring a professional technician for the installation.

Which soap should I use in a dishwasher?

Basically the dishwasher uses two products: soap and rinse aid drying liquid. The soap can be found in liquid, powder or small bars.

The use of rinse aid is important so that the dishes are not stained during drying.

Although more expensive, the products yield a lot. Make sure that specific products for use in the dishwasher are available in your region.

Each dishwasher has specific compartments for supplying soap and drying liquid. Make sure to fill up correctly and with the indicated amount to avoid waste.

Capacity

It is essential to evaluate the amount of dirty dishes produced daily in the place where the dishwasher will be used. This is the most important factor in choosing the model to be purchased.

This is because, in order to take full advantage of the machine’s performance, avoiding waste of water and energy, the ideal is that the dishwasher always works with 100% of its capacity filled.

It is also worth remembering that the machine may have its performance and the quality of the washings impaired when operating with a quantity of crockery above capacity.

A tip for when you have little dirty dishes, is to accumulate the containers of two or more meals before starting the washing.

If this practice is necessary in your home, prefer models with programs that launch water jets or perform a light rinse on the stored dishes. This avoids a bad smell, and the residues are dried out while waiting for washing.

Model

The choice of the model should not only be aesthetic, but also consider the space in which the device will be installed. Basically there are 3 types of dishwasher: the floor, inlaid and table.

  • Floor : Can be installed directly on the floor.
  • Built-in : They are dishwashers that fit into the carpentry of the environment.
  • Table : Can be placed on benches, tables or other surfaces.

Properly evaluating the space available for the installation is essential to get the purchase right.

Generally, the same models come in white, silver or stainless options. These characteristics are only aesthetic. The most common is to match the color with the other household appliances in the room. White machines tend to have lower prices than silver / stainless steel.

Water and energy consumption

High energy consumption, as we have already mentioned, is a myth connected with dishwashers. The newer models have evolved, with very satisfactory savings rates.

Even so, it is worth checking the average consumption of the model chosen before purchase. Make sure to use the official data, which are on Inmetro’s energy efficiency seal.

Based on the average weekly usage, calculate the final impact that the use of the dishwasher will have on your energy bill.

The highest consumption occurs at the time of drying and in case of using hot water for washing. To save money, use cycles without heated water and skip the drying step, allowing the dishes to dry naturally.

Also check the water consumption of the chosen model. Some have economical washing mode. Others, like washing machines, make it possible to reuse water after washing, making the savings even greater.

It is worth remembering that the reuse of water requires a special installation. If you want to use this functionality, make sure the model offers this possibility and that the installation is done according to the purpose.

Technical assistance

As it is a durable good, the dishwasher may need maintenance or repairs at some point.

To avoid future headaches, a thorough search before purchase is important. Make sure that the chosen brand offers authorized technical assistance in your region or in locations that you have easy access to.

Search online sales sites, or even on the brand’s own page for consumers’ opinions regarding the model you have chosen. Assess issues such as: incidence of defects, routine maintenance and overhauls, availability of spare parts, value of repairs and spare parts.
